170613-N-ZW825-995 ZHANJIANG, China (June 13, 2017) Sailors assigned to the Arleigh Burke-class guided-missile destroyer USS Sterett (DDG 104) prepare lunch in the ship’s galley with People’s Liberation Army (Navy) (PLAN) sailors during a scheduled port visit to Zhanjiang, China. Sterett is part of the Sterett-Dewey Surface Action Group and is the third deploying group operating under the command and control construct called 3rd Fleet Forward.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 1st Class Byron C. Linder/Released)
